Syllabus
Syllabus mentioned in ERP
Introduction to water distribution system to different sectors: Domestic, Industrial, Agricultural. Present status of water distribution system in India and Abroad. Types of distribution system: Pipe network, canal network system, lift irrigation. Sources of water distribution system: surface storage reservoirs and run-of-the-river (weirs/ barrages) diversion schemes, surface ponds, open wells, dug wells, tube wells, infiltration galleries, collector wells. Flow mass curve analysis for design of reservoir capacity.Water demandsupply analysis through population forecasting. Drinking and irrigation water quality standards. Assessment of drinking and irrigation water demands.Components of domestic water supply system; Hydraulics of domestic pipe network design: Single network, looped network. Minimization of losses in domestic water supply system.Pumping systems and storage structures. Design of pressurized distribution system with associated controls and storage structures for drinking and irrigation water supplies; Introduction to pipe network design software EPANET.Automation techniques for drinking water distribution systems using SCADA.Principles of Canal system design. Overview of major and minor conveyance and distribution systems for irrigation water (canals, control structures, cross drainage works, distributaries, water courses and field channel for gravity irrigation) including the design of these systems; lift irrigation system. Canal hydraulics (computer simulation) models, canal scheduling (Warabandi, Shejpali, rotational), Computer models of canal operation.Design of pressurized irrigation system (Drip and Sprinkler system).
